D&E Communications Announces Dividend
* Reuters is not responsible for the content in this press release.
EPHRATA, PA, Jul 30 (MARKET WIRE) --
The Board of Directors of D&E Communications, Inc. (NASDAQ: DECC)
announced a quarterly dividend of $0.167 (16.7 cents) per share of common
stock payable on October 15, 2009, to shareholders of record on September
30, 2009, maintaining the Company's current annual dividend rate of $0.50
(50.0 cents) per share.
As required by the Agreement and Plan of Merger ("Merger Agreement") dated
May 10, 2009 with Windstream Corporation, D&E has adjusted its dividend
record date and payment date to correspond to Windstream's dividend record
date and payment date. This change is designed to assure that D&E
shareholders are entitled to either a dividend on D&E common stock or
Windstream common stock, but not both, with regard to the calendar quarter
in which the merger occurs. Therefore, if the merger closes prior to the
close of business on September 30, 2009, D&E common shares will be
converted into and become exchangeable for (i) 0.650 shares of common
stock of Windstream and (ii) $5.00 in cash and will be eligible to receive
dividends, if any, on their Windstream common stock. If the merger closes
subsequent to the close of business on September 30, 2009, D&E
shareholders of record on such date will receive the D&E dividend. D&E
has adjusted the amount of its dividend to $0.167 per share to maintain
an annual dividend rate of $0.50 per share, as permitted by the Merger
Agreement, to reflect the fact that there is a four-month period between
the scheduled payment date for the current D&E dividend and the most
recent D&E dividend payment date of June 15, 2009.
D&E is a leading integrated communications provider offering high-speed
data, Internet access, local and long distance telephone, business
continuity services, co-location facilities, data and professional IT
services, network monitoring, security solutions and video services. Based
in Lancaster County, D&E has been serving communities in central and
eastern Pennsylvania for more than 100 years. For more information, visit
